Dear all, I have a problem with plotting. I have an irregular set of data, where latitude is listed from bigger to smaller values. So, I cannot plot with image.plot. On the other hand, quilt.plot solves the problem, but it can't take the definition of color. It gives the feedback:
Error in image.plot(out.p, col = tim.colors(64), ...) : formal argument "col" matched by multiple actual arguments The question is: is there a way to define the color palette in quilt.plot?
